consisting of 29 works of paper, one double-sided, by various artists for Odessa, Kharkov, Kiev and Baku theaters of Opera and Ballet. The set includes among others designs for the opera possibly for the Kharkov Theater of Opera and Ballet; costumes for Elsa von Brabant from composed by Richard Wagner, possibly for the Kharkov Theater of Opera and Ballet; a costume design for the Pharaoh`s daughter Amneris from by Verdi; costume designs for composed by Petr Tchaikovsky; multiple costume designs for ballets choreographed by Vakhtang Vronsky (1905-1988) for Odessa, Kiev and Baku theaters, including with music by Afrasiyab Badalbayli. Gouache, watercolor, ink and pencil on paper. Various sizes with the largest measuring 38.1 x 23.7 cm (15 x 9 3/8 in.).
